Square Enix scheduled Deus EX: Human Revolution version for Macs this winter 2011/2012 but the winter is coming to and end and Square is still mute but thank to the "amazing" ESRB age rating system we know that the game is still in its path and not vaporware.
According to Joystiq:
Square Enix has a little less than a month to meet the planned "winter 2011/2012" release date for Deus Ex: Human Revolution on Mac. There's no cybernetic implant that can foresee the future but, thanks to the ESRB, we do have at least one sign that Deus Ex is still on the way to Apple machines.
The organization has posted a rating for an "Ultimate Edition" of the game for Mac, which is presumably even more ultimate than the Augmented Edition released on other platforms last year. The game has been rated M for egregious pheromone usage. Or killing. Probably killing. |
